ホームページ  >  記事  >  ウェブフロントエンド  >  jQuery の場合: セレクターの使用例が含まれます。

jQuery の場合: セレクターの使用例が含まれます。

WBOY
WBOYオリジナル
2016-05-16 16:23:151191ブラウズ

この記事の例では、jQuery での contains セレクターの使用法について説明します。皆さんの参考に共有してください。具体的な分析は次のとおりです。

このセレクターは、指定されたテキストを含む要素と一致します。
構文:

コードをコピー コードは次のとおりです:
$(":contains(text)")

このセレクターは通常、クラス セレクター、要素セレクターなどの他のセレクターと組み合わせて使用​​されます。例:

コードをコピー コードは次のとおりです:
$("li:contains('html')").css ("色","青")

上記のコードは、テキストに「html」を含む li 要素のフォントの色を青に設定します。
他のセレクターと一緒に使用しない場合、デフォルトの状態は * セレクターとともに使用されます。たとえば、$(":contains") は $("*:contains") と同等です。
パラメータリスト:

参数 描述
text 一个用以查找的字符串。

コード例:

例 1:

コードをコピーします コードは次のとおりです:



<頭>


スクリプト ホーム

<スクリプトタイプ="text/javascript"> $(document).ready(function(){
$("ボタン").click(function(){
$("li:contains('html')").css("color","blue")
})
})




  • html エリア

  • div CSS エリア

  • JQuery ゾーン

  • JavaScript ゾーン

  • html5 エリア






上記のコードは、「html」を含む li 要素のテキストの色を青に設定できます。

例 2:

コードをコピーします コードは次のとおりです:


<頭>


スクリプト ホーム

<スクリプトタイプ="text/javascript"> $(document).ready(function(){
$("ボタン").click(function(){
$("*:contains('html')").css("border","1px 単色赤")
})
})




  • html エリア

  • div CSS エリア

  • JQuery ゾーン

  • JavaScript ゾーン

  • html5 エリア


スクリプト ホーム






上記のコードでは、:even セレクターで使用されるセレクターが指定されていないため、デフォルトでは * セレクターで使用されます。

この記事が皆さんの jQuery プログラミングに役立つことを願っています。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。